RC@ Postado Outubro 5, 2006 Denunciar Share Postado Outubro 5, 2006 Olá pessoal..Seguinte.. Eu preciso pegar os dados de um arquivo CSV e importar para uma tabela no mysql..A importação é feita com sucesso, exceto por um pequeno detalhe..Alguns campos, no arquivo CSV estão em branco.. (seriam NULL).. mas quando eu importo pro mysql, onde deveria estar NULL, esses campos são preenchidos com valor 0...Eu gostaria que os campos fossem NULL... pois, onde é realmente pra ter 0, ficar 0, e onde não é pra ter NADA, não ter NADA (NULL).. Já vi se os campos estão setados como NULL, e estão.. inclusive com valor pradrão NULL...Então.. da onde surgem os 0's ???alguém pode me ajudar??Abraços!! Link para o comentário Compartilhar em outros sites More sharing options...
0 lcs_sp Postado Outubro 6, 2006 Denunciar Share Postado Outubro 6, 2006 Olá RC@,Campos em branco são diferentes de campos nulos, por isso ele grava campo em branco no banco de dados. Link para o comentário Compartilhar em outros sites More sharing options...
0 Guest Visitante Postado Outubro 6, 2006 Denunciar Share Postado Outubro 6, 2006 E como eu faço então pra ele gravar campos nulos?? Ou melhor.. deixar os campos nulos, nulos... Tipo.. como eu falo pra ele que um espaço em branco na "lista" de dados deve ser um campo nulo? E não um campo em branco?Eu deveria "retirar" o campo da "lista"??Vlw Link para o comentário Compartilhar em outros sites More sharing options...
0 Beraldo Postado Outubro 6, 2006 Denunciar Share Postado Outubro 6, 2006 Use NULL.Abraço Link para o comentário Compartilhar em outros sites More sharing options...
0 Guest mfabianosm Postado Março 4, 2008 Denunciar Share Postado Março 4, 2008 Pessoal, eu estou tentando importar um arquivo csv e gravar no banco de dados mas não estou conseguindo. Eu tenho um formulário master e no detail tem um botão para inserir manualmente ou importar. Manualmente consegui legal, mas importando não. Alguém poderia me ajudar? Estou usando delphi 7, componente Zeos, banco SQLITE.Obrigado.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
RC@
Olá pessoal..
Seguinte..
Eu preciso pegar os dados de um arquivo CSV e importar para uma tabela no mysql..
A importação é feita com sucesso, exceto por um pequeno detalhe..
Alguns campos, no arquivo CSV estão em branco.. (seriam NULL).. mas quando eu importo
pro mysql, onde deveria estar NULL, esses campos são preenchidos com valor 0...
Eu gostaria que os campos fossem NULL... pois, onde é realmente pra ter 0, ficar 0,
e onde não é pra ter NADA, não ter NADA (NULL)..
Já vi se os campos estão setados como NULL, e estão.. inclusive com valor pradrão NULL...
Então.. da onde surgem os 0's ???
alguém pode me ajudar??
Abraços!!
Link para o comentário
Compartilhar em outros sites
4 respostass a esta questão
Posts Recomendados